要在Mac下连接MySQL数据库,首先需要安装MySQL客户端工具,然后使用命令行或图形化界面连接到数据库。具体操作包括启动MySQL服务、创建连接文件、配置连接参数等步骤。

在macOS系统中连接MySQL数据库文件,主要涉及MySQL的安装、配置以及如何使用Navicat等可视化工具进行连接,以下将详细阐述这一过程:

mac下连接mysql数据库文件_Macmac下连接mysql数据库文件_Mac图片来源网络,侵删)

1、安装MySQL

使用Homebrew安装:Homebrew是macOS的包管理工具,通过Homebrew安装MySQL相对简单且方便,首先需要安装Homebrew,然后在终端中运行命令brew install mysql即可安装MySQL,安装完成后,启动MySQL服务的命令为brew services start mysql,若遇到权限问题,可通过修改相关目录和文件的权限解决。

官网下载安装:直接访问MySQL官网下载适合macOS的安装包,并进行标准安装流程,在安装过程中设置root密码,安装成功后在系统偏好设置中可以看到MySQL的标识。

2、配置MySQL

初始安全设置:安装MySQL后,需要进行初始的安全配置,运行mysql_secure_installation命令启动安全安装程序,按照引导设置root密码,并回答一系列安全问题来加强MySQL的安全性。

配置文件调整:为了方便使用,可以通过修改配置文件来添加MySQL的执行路径,编辑~/.bash_profile文件,加入export PATH=${PATH}:/usr/local/mysql/bin,之后通过source ~/.bash_profile命令使配置生效。

3、Navicat连接MySQL

mac下连接mysql数据库文件_Macmac下连接mysql数据库文件_Mac(图片来源网络,侵删)

Navicat安装与配置:下载并安装Navicat for MySQL的Mac版本,打开Navicat后选择连接MySQL,输入连接名及MySQL的root密码,点击测试连接确保一切正常,如果遇到认证问题,可能需要在MySQL命令行中使用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'你的密码';命令更改认证方式。

4、常见问题及解决策略

Access denied问题:如果在连接Navicat时出现访问被拒绝的错误,可能是因为MySQL的验证方式与Navicat不兼容,更改MySQL的用户验证方式通常可以解决这个问题。

权限问题:当无法启动MySQL服务时,通常是因为权限不足,确保所有相关目录和文件的权限正确设置给当前用户和管理员组。

通过上述步骤,用户可以在macOS系统上顺利安装、配置MySQL,并通过Navicat等工具进行有效的数据库管理和操作,这些操作对于开发者来说至关重要,因为它们提供了一种便捷的方式来处理和管理数据库,特别是在本地开发环境中。

mac下连接mysql数据库文件_Macmac下连接mysql数据库文件_Mac(图片来源网络,侵删)

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。